The Importance of Proper Tire Pressure
Tire pressure refers to the amount of air inside your tires. It’s measured in pounds per square inch (PSI) and is crucial for a variety of reasons:
Safety
Maintaining the recommended tire pressure is essential for safe driving. Underinflated tires increase the risk of blowouts, especially at high speeds. They also reduce traction, making it harder to steer and brake effectively, particularly in wet or slippery conditions. Overinflated tires, on the other hand, offer less contact with the road surface, leading to decreased grip and handling, and increasing the risk of skidding.
Fuel Efficiency
Underinflated tires create more rolling resistance, forcing your engine to work harder and consume more fuel. Maintaining the correct tire pressure can improve your fuel economy by up to 3%. This translates to significant savings over time, especially for frequent drivers.
Tire Wear and Longevity
Incorrect tire pressure can lead to uneven tire wear. Underinflation causes the tire’s center to wear down faster, while overinflation leads to excessive wear on the tire’s edges. Proper inflation ensures even weight distribution and prolongs the life of your tires.
Vehicle Handling and Performance
The correct tire pressure contributes to optimal vehicle handling and performance. It ensures a smooth and comfortable ride, improves steering responsiveness, and enhances braking efficiency.
Finding the Ideal Tire Pressure
The ideal tire pressure for your car is not a one-size-fits-all figure. It varies depending on several factors, including your vehicle’s make, model, year, and load capacity.
Checking Your Owner’s Manual
The most accurate source of information regarding your car’s recommended tire pressure is your owner’s manual. It typically lists the recommended pressure for both front and rear tires, as well as for different load conditions.
Tire Information Label
Another reliable source is the tire information label, usually located on the driver’s side doorjamb. This label often displays the recommended tire pressure for your vehicle. (See Also: How to Tell if Tires Are Unbalanced? Signs To Watch For)
Tire Sidewall
The sidewall of your tire also provides information about its maximum pressure rating. However, this is the maximum pressure the tire can withstand, not necessarily the recommended pressure for your vehicle.
Measuring Tire Pressure
To accurately measure your tire pressure, you’ll need a tire pressure gauge. These are readily available at most auto parts stores and gas stations.
Steps for Measuring Tire Pressure
- Park your car on a level surface and ensure the tires are cold. Measuring pressure when the tires are warm can lead to inaccurate readings.
- Remove the valve cap from the tire valve stem.
- Press the tire pressure gauge firmly onto the valve stem.
- Read the pressure displayed on the gauge.
- Record the pressure reading and repeat the process for each tire.
Adjusting Tire Pressure
If your tire pressure is too low, you can add air using an air compressor. If it’s too high, you can release some air by pressing the small pin in the center of the valve stem with a tire pressure gauge or a special tool.
Tips for Adjusting Tire Pressure
- Add or release air in small increments to avoid overinflating or underinflating the tires.
- Check the pressure frequently, especially before long trips or when driving in extreme temperatures.
- Use a reliable tire pressure gauge for accurate readings.
Factors Affecting Tire Pressure
Several factors can influence your tire pressure, including:
Temperature
Tire pressure increases with temperature. When the air inside your tires heats up, it expands, leading to higher pressure. Conversely, tire pressure decreases as the temperature drops.
Load
Carrying heavy loads in your vehicle increases the weight pressing down on the tires, requiring higher tire pressure to maintain the proper ride height and handling.
Altitude
As altitude increases, the air pressure decreases. This can result in lower tire pressure, requiring you to adjust the pressure accordingly.
Age

FAQs
What happens if I drive with underinflated tires?
Driving with underinflated tires can lead to a variety of problems, including increased risk of blowouts, reduced fuel efficiency, uneven tire wear, and compromised handling and braking.
How often should I check my tire pressure?
It’s recommended to check your tire pressure at least once a month, or more frequently if you drive in extreme temperatures or carry heavy loads.
What is the best time to check tire pressure?

What is the difference between PSI and kPa?
PSI (pounds per square inch) and kPa (kilopascals) are both units of pressure. 1 PSI is approximately equal to 6.89 kPa.
